Davante Adams bids his Packers goodbye with heartfelt Instagram post

After dealing with the Las Vegas Raiders, wide-ranging recipient Davante Adams wrote a goodbye message to the Green Bay Packers and their fans on Instagram.

Green Bay Packers fans were delighted to see full-back Aaron Rodgers officially sign a three-year contract to stay at the team. But days later, the fan base was completely shocked after hearing that the Packers widely received star traded Davante Adams to the Las Vegas Raiders in exchange for the 2022 first- and second-round draft picks. Additionally, Adams received a five-year, $141.25 million contract from the Raiders.

Davante Adams writes farewell message to Packers fans

Adams was a 2014 second-round draft pick by the Packers out of Fresno State, and ended up not only becoming one of the franchise’s best wide receivers in history, but also one of the catchers. best pass in the entire NFL.

In his eight seasons, Adams scored more than 1,000 ball picks in three of them. Not only that, he won the Pro Bowl for 5 consecutive seasons from 2017-21 and was named to the All Pro First Team for 2020 and 2021.

Overall, Adams caught 669 of 1,012 goals in 8,121 yards and 73 touchdowns.

This season, the Packers put a franchise tag on Adams in hopes of negotiating a new deal. Adam’s agent confirmed to NFL network insider Ian Rapoport that Green Bay offered more money to stay with the team, but they said it was “a lifelong dream to be with the Raiders.” Not only that, but he was reunited with his former Fresno State teammate and quarterback Derek Carr.

Adams will likely play for the Raiders in 2022 and beyond, but he wanted to let fans know that he appreciates their support over the years.
